Dubai Mallathon Concludes with Record-Breaking Participation

The Dubai Mallathon closed on Sunday after a 31-day run that attracted more than 40,000 participants of all ages and nationalities. Together, they achieved an impressive 120 million steps, turning shopping malls into fitness hubs across the city.
The event took place on indoor, air-conditioned walking tracks inside nine major Dubai malls, ensuring a safe and comfortable environment for residents and visitors.
Key Highlights of the Dubai Mallathon
- Duration: 31 days
- Participants: 40,000+ people
- Steps Logged: 120 million
- Venues: 9 leading shopping malls in Dubai
This initiative not only encouraged physical activity but also demonstrated how malls can serve as community spaces that go beyond shopping. Families, fitness enthusiasts, and casual walkers joined in, creating a collective movement that celebrated health and wellness.
